Address

PtmmmppffFSgAecfTKG6YuboMD7PzjGbBL

0 PEPE

Confirmed
Total Received33466.22120000 PEPE33.53 USD
Total Sent33466.22120000 PEPE33.53 USD
Final Balance0 PEPE0.00 USD
No. Transactions2

Transactions

PtmmmppffFSgAecfTKG6YuboMD7PzjGbBL33466.22120000 PEPE34.74 USD33.53 USD
 
PndfSY6WhiTfZVuLPRA9xgGsTGTGJmGPvt33461.21894000 PEPE34.74 USD33.53 USD
Pn8fSA7aQAo5J4hkin1PxGtd2jc9EnRQcK5.00000000 PEPE0.01 USD0.01 USD×
PoQv5KtSzxF2mEjApAh8DAjEpeuTwqpvDw33471.22346000 PEPE34.75 USD33.54 USD
 
PtmmmppffFSgAecfTKG6YuboMD7PzjGbBL33466.22120000 PEPE34.74 USD33.53 USD
PnBpcGtLwozn8YrHS4h7oENLCiWacd7ecG5.00000000 PEPE0.01 USD0.01 USD×